This year, the PC market will again shrink sharply, but IDC predicts light at the end of the tunnel. 2024 is likely to be a year of growth, but the analysts are not expecting too much either.
In 2023, the entire PC market is expected to shrink by 13.7 percent compared to the previous year. That’s what IDC predicts. The total number of devices shipped would be 252 million. These numbers are not surprising: the downward trend has been very clear since the end of the corona pandemic. Economic uncertainty and a spending spree during the pandemic itself are at the root of the decline.
In the next year the market will slowly stabilize. IDC expects growth to pick up again in 2024, although growth will remain modest and even below pre-pandemic levels. Specifically, the analysts are assuming that sales will increase by around 3.7 percent to 259.6 million computers next year.
segment | 2023 deliveries | Growth 2023/2022 | 2027 deliveries | Growth 2027/2026 | 2023-2027 CAGR |
consumer | 112.0 | -16.2% | 124.8 | 1.6% | 2.7% |
Training | 31.1 | -11.2% | 35.7 | 0.1% | 3.5% |
Commercial (ex. Edu) | 108.9 | -11.7% | 124.5 | 2.4% | 3.4% |
In total | 252.0 | -13.7% | 284.9 | 1.7% | 3.1% |
According to IDC, AI is a driver, but other factors also play a role. The end of official support for Windows 10 is scheduled for 2025. Due to the (artificially) high system requirements of Windows 11, the options are limited for many users. If a software upgrade doesn’t work, a hardware upgrade is the only option to stay on the safe side. IDC anticipates that this reality will significantly increase computer sales.
